Put your title, name, and contact information on the front page. Come up with a title for your screenplay and write it in all caps in the center of the page. Add a line break after the title and type the phrase “written by” in all lowercase. Then put another line break before putting your first and last name. citicards exchange rateWebThe first page of your screenplay is called the Title Page.
